Duffy’s 4 Wickets Seal New Zealand’s 3-1 T20I Series Win Over West Indies

Both teams shift to a three-match ODI series starting Sunday in Christchurch.

Overview

  • Mitchell Santner won the toss and chose to bowl in overcast Dunedin, where New Zealand remain unbeaten in T20Is at University Oval.
  • West Indies collapsed to 21-4 and were bowled out for 140 in 18.4 overs, with Jacob Duffy taking 4-35 including three wickets in one over.
  • Jacob Duffy finished the series with 10 wickets to earn Player of the Series honors.
  • New Zealand cruised to 141-2 in 15.4 overs, with Devon Conway unbeaten on 47 and Tim Robinson striking 45 to set up the chase.
  • The ODI leg of the tour follows: Hagley Oval on Sunday, McLean Park on Nov. 19, and Seddon Park on Nov. 22.
